Take Photos of Your Property Pre-Road Construction, Rozelle Residents Warned

BUILDING inspection giant Archicentre has warned residents in Sydney’s inner-west to take digital photos of their properties, ahead of major new roadworks nearby, which threaten to damage of their properties.

“At the very least all home owners should be taking a digital photographic record of their homes and its condition inside and out with a date stamp on the shots to record the conditions of their home for any legal disputes in the future,” Archicentre state manager Angus Kell told the Daily Telegraph.

He added if this was not possible, residents should commission reports on their homes detailing any damage caused.
